Category Archives: Tecnología

TINETcongres, 1er día

Este viernes asistí al primer dia del TINETcongrés, aunque llegué un poco tarde y me perdí las primeras charlas (la inauguración, Mercè Gisbert y Jordi Tiñena) 🙁 En general hubieron algunas historias interesantes, pero también ofrecieron alguna que otra charla muy aburrida como Leda Guidi de Iperbole (Bolonia) y Fiorella de Cindio de ReteCivica (Milán) que nos presentaron sus redes ciudadanas hablando mucho pero diciendo poco 🙁

Por otro lado, Vicent Partal de Vilaweb dio una charla interesante sobre “Comunicación” y la ponencia de Enric Brull dió una visión más general de la red TINET. También hubo una charla improvisada de una persona (creo que su nombre era Jaume pero no recuerdo el apellido) encargada de la formación informática de gente de la tercera edad, ofreció anécdotas bastante interesantes.

Finalmente Jose Luis Pardos de Si, Spain también nos comentó algunas anécdotas de cuando era embajador en Canadá, cuando todavía no existía ni la web.

Quizás con lo que me quedo de esta primera sesión es con la experiencia de formar a gente de la tercera edad. Veo que hay un gran entusiasmo tanto los educadores como los que reciben la educación, sin embargo, no parecen darse cuenta que toda esta tecnología que alaban es privativa y el conocimiento al que están llegando esta limitado y ligado a esa característica:

  • Una persona de la tercera edad que aprenda a utilizar Microsoft Office, debe comprarse una licencia de Windows y Office para su casa y así poder hacer sus documentos?
  • Una persona de la tercera edad que quiera redactar sus vivencias y por tanto, almacenar información privada en su ordenador debe confiar en Software que no es transparente?

Por supuesto los responsables no son las personas de la tercera edad, sino los formadores que deben tomar conciencia de la situación.

Por otro lado, estas mismas personas tienen importantes inquietudes que cubrir, no se limitan al uso del procesador de textos o del navegador, sino que cada día solicitan más actividades como la videoconferencia, tratamiento de imágenes para recuperar y restaurar fotos antiguas que aun conservan (aunque en mal estado), tratamiento de vídeo para hacer sus montajes y enviarselo a sus familiares lejanos.

Es en este terreno en el que tengo la sensación que como comunidad del Software Libre, no estamos preparados para dar aplicaciones fáciles de utilizar que puedan cubrir esas necesidades. Tenemos problemas con el reconocimiento de webcams (los responsables son las empresas de hardware, pero no por eso podemos cerrar los ojos), no tenemos programas de retoque fotográfico sencillos (Gimp es genial, pero complicado), no tenemos programas de montaje de vídeo sencillos (MainActor es para linux pero privativo, Cinelerra es muy complicado y no lo tenemos ni en respositorios Debian/Ubuntu, etc..). A veces parece que hemos avanzado mucho, pero la verdad es que aun nos queda mucho camino por recorrer.

Volviendo al TINETcongres, el sábado de la semana que viene toca sesión sobre Software Libre y Joni presentará nuestra asociación GPL Tarragona a los ciudadanos de Tarragona 🙂

Origen del CTRL + ALT + Supr.

Según leo en Bootlog y LatinDeveloper, el CTRL + ALT + Supr. surgió de la mano de David J. Bradley como ayuda a los desarrolladores, los cuales a la hora de programar era frecuente enfrentarse a cuelgues inesperados, y por tanto necesitaban poder reiniciar la máquina de forma rápida. En ningún caso se trataba de una utilidad que tuviese que llegar al usuario final, pues se suponía que este ya tendría el software libre de errores (o al menos de los más gordos).



Incluso existe un vídeo de David J. Bradley donde llega a decir: “En todo caso, tengo que compartir el crédito. Yo pude haber inventado el Ctrl + Alt + Del, pero fue Bill quien lo hizo famoso”.”

Nuevas licencias Microsoft Shared Source

Por lo visto Microsoft ha publicado 3 nuevas licencias en su programa Shared Source Iniciative.

  • Microsoft Permissive License (Ms-PL): Permite ver, modificar, redistribuir el código fuente para uso tanto no comercial como comercial. Libre de royalties. No es necesario mantener copyright, patentes, marcas, etc… No hay ninguna obligación de publicar tus cambios en formato ni binario ni en código fuente.
  • Microsoft Limited Permissive License (Ms-LPL): Igual que la anterior pero solo válida para plataformas Windows.
  • Microsoft Community License (Ms-CL): Permite ver, modificar, redistribuir el código fuente para uso tanto no comercial como comercial. Libre de royalties. Tiene un comportamiento vírico como la GPL, pero solo afecta fichero a fichero. Si en un fichero se incluye un función ya implementada bajo esa licencia, el resto del fichero pasa a estar bajo la licencia sin afectar al resto del proyecto (e.g. el resto de ficheros podrían tener licencia diferente).
  • Microsoft Limited Community License (Ms-LCL): Igual que la anterior pero solo válida para plataformas Windows.
  • Microsoft Reference License (Ms-RL): Solo se permite ver el código fuente para ser usado como referencia.

La Free Software Foundation ha empezado a estudiarlas, pero en una primera revisión rápida ya se ha comentado que la Ms-PL y la Ms-CL podrían estar dentro de la definición de software libre (cumplen las 4 libertades). De hecho, remarcan lo curioso que resulta que la Ms-CL tenga un comportamiento, aunque diferente a la GPL, vírico… característica que ha sido utilizada por Microsoft para desacreditar el Software Libre tiempo atrás.

Como bien dicen en la FSF, ahora lo importante es publicar Software Libre y no licencias libres, pues de estas ya tenemos muchas y es absurdo que cada empresa cree nuevas con nombres distintos y características similares.

Flock, el navegador social del futuro

Estoy escribiendo esta entrada desde Flock 0.5pre, o lo que es lo mismo, un navegador social basado en Firefox y con una integración impresionante con los servicios:

  • Blogging: Permite escribir posts en blogs (wordpress, blogger, etc…)
    mediante una aplicación integrada del estilo WYSIWYG, es decir, como si
    fuese un procesador de texto. El usuario no necesita saber HTML, de
    hecho el screenshot que adjunto lo he arrastrado desde una cuenta en flickr.
  • Flickr: Integración con dicho servicio de fotografia/imágenes.
  • Marcadores/Favoritos: Integración total con del.icio.us, mantiene los marcadores en la red, podemos catalogar nuestro links con tags, etc…
  • Búsqueda histórica: grácias al engince Clucene, a medida que visitamos páginas estas se van indexando de forma que podemos buscar cosas que ya hemos visitado.
  • Lector de feeds: Potenciación del RSS
  • Estanteria: Podemos arrastrar trozos de texto a nuestra estanteria, de esta forma podemos guardar noticias de internet que queramos poner en nuestro blog más tarde.

Lo cierto es que promete muchisimo, actualmente lo encuentro todavia bastante verde… por ejemplo ahora me he estado peleando con el editor para poder hacer este post con el formateo que queria :-D. Por tanto descarto comentarlo en la guía de Ubuntu.

Es impresionante lo innovador que es este navegador, para que luego digan que no se innova en el mundo del Software Libre. Tiene la pinta de que puede suponer toda una revolución en la navegación web, sobretodo en aquellas personas que les gusta tener su blog, subir sus fotos y compartir sus enlaces. Os recomiendo que le echeis un vistazo, personalmente tengo ganas de ver hasta donde puede llegar Flock 🙂

Recorte de imagenes en massa

Para la nueva versión de la guia Breezy he utilizado qemu en lugar de vmware, aparte de ser más lento, el inconveniente con el que me encuentro es que no he podido hacer las capturas directamente desde el programa y me he visto obligado a usar el capturar ventana (ALT+Impr. Pant.) de GNOME. Esto ha hecho que ahora tenga un montón de screenshots donde se ve el escritorio de la Ubuntu instalada en el qemu, rodeado por la ventana de mi escritorio real.

Para poder quitar ese “adorno” podria hacerlo a mano con el Gimp, pero al ser demasiadas he buscado un método alternativo que me permitiese hacerlo de forma automatizada. He buscado por la documentación de ImageMakick (que proporciona comandos de consola para tratamiento de imágenes) y he acabado aplicando en el directorio donde tengo los screenshots esto:

mogrify -shave 4x4 -chop 0x18 *.png

Esto hace que quite 18 pixels de la parte superior de la imagen (corresponde a la barra de titulo de la ventana) y 4 pixels de la parte superior, inferior, lateral derecho y lateral izquierdo que corresponde al contorno de la ventana. Así los screenshots ahora solo muestran el contenido de qemu, sin la ventana que lo contiene 🙂

Atajos de teclado de OpenOffice 2.0

Es horrible que en OpenOffice 2.0 (en Ubuntu Breezy ya trabajamos con el) hayan cambiado los atajo de teclados y los hayan adaptado al idioma del sistema, si lo tenemos en castellano:

  • Guardar pasa a ser CTRL+g, cuando normalmente es CTRL+s
  • Buscar pasa a ser CTRL+b, cuando normalmente es CTRL+f
  • Etc…

Lo único que se consigue con ese cambio es que te equivoques constantemente, si pulso CTRL+s para guardar, lo que realmente hace es activar el “subrayado” 🙁 Por no decir, que si usamos cualquier otra aplicación de GNOME se sigue manteniendo los atajos de toda la vida… por ejemplo en gedit CTRL+s sigue siendo guardar.

Los atajos de teclado deberían seguir un estándar, igual que la cruz de una ventana siempre significa cerrar, el CTRL+s debería significar guardar (save). Así serian válidos independientemente de la configuración del idioma del sistema.

Imaginad una terminal donde los comandos cambiasen en función de el idioma del sistema :S En cualquier caso, considero este tipo de problemas graves errores de usabilidad 🙁

Google Talk y gaim, contactos sin autorización

Recientemente he entrado en Windows y al abrir Google Talk me he dado cuenta que tengo más contactos añadidos de los que creía sin haber aceptado ninguna autorización :S Desde hace tiempo uso el servicio de Google Talk desde GNU/Linux con Gaim gracias a que utiliza el protocolo Jabber, por lo visto durante todo este tiempo, aquellas personas que me han escrito desde su correo gmail a mi correo gmail se han ido agregando al servicio de Google Talk sin que me mostrase ninguna autorización.

Ya me ocurrió algo similar con Joni, que fue el primer contacto que tuve… pero pensé que se trataba de un error por su estado beta, pero ahora me hace sospechar que cuando uno de los 2 contactos utiliza Gaim, no se produce en ningún momento el aviso de autorización.

A ver si mejora Gaim ahora que Google ha contratado al principal desarrollador de Gaim.

Patrocinador guia Ubuntu Breezy GNU/Linux

La empresa Maxima OKE y su futura división Maxima Linux, con afán de ampliar su gamma de servicios y acercarse al mundo del Software Libre, patrocinará la actualización y ampliación de la guía Ubuntu que yo mismo desarrollo.

El pasado jueves 13 de octubre conocí personalmente a los responsables de la nueva división, Joan Carles Sanchez (software) y Joan Meya (hardware). La impresión con la que me quedé fue muy positiva, son personas que entienden a la perfección la filosofía del Software Libre y quieren ofrecer sus beneficios a sus clientes. A pesar de convertirme en un simple colaborador, me sentí muy bien acogido por la empresa 🙂

Este tipo de iniciativas son realmente muy positivas para la comunidad, sobretodo cuando la empresa en cuestión desea implicarse en cooperación con la misma comunidad. Por otro lado también es fantástico ver como hay empresas locales que empiezan a ofrecer servicios alrededor de productos libres, creo que es un mercado que esta aún por explotar y se puede llegar muy lejos 🙂

La nueva guía, además de ser actualizada y ampliada, gracias a Maxima OKE también será traducida al Catalán, contribuyendo así a la actualmente pequeña biblioteca existente de documentación técnica en Catalán.

En resumen, ya estoy trabajando en la nueva versión y espero tenerla lista cuanto antes 🙂